A maintenance controller performs maintenance and repairs on aircraft. As a maintenance controller, your responsibilities are to ensure that all aircraft at an airport or airfield meet appropriate quality standards and safety requirements and are ready for flight. Your duties include scheduling maintenance, logging all repairs, and coordinating with pilots to identify any issues that may occur with their planes. You also review flight logs to determine hardware issues, make calls to airplane manufacturers to obtain necessary parts for repairs, and ensure the general mechanicals of the airplanes.
| Aspect | Maintenance Controller | Maintenance Planner |
|---|---|---|
| Primary Role | Coordinates daily maintenance activities, manages work orders, and ensures timely completion of maintenance tasks. | Prepares and schedules maintenance work, plans resources, and develops maintenance strategies. |
| Required Credentials | Typically requires technical certifications or experience in maintenance operations. | Often requires technical background and planning or scheduling certifications. |
| Work Environment | Operational settings such as factories, airports, or transportation hubs. | Office-based with field visits for planning and coordination. |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Used in industries like aviation, manufacturing, and transportation. | Common in similar industries for maintenance management. |
While both roles support maintenance operations, the Maintenance Controller focuses on executing and managing daily maintenance tasks, whereas the Maintenance Planner emphasizes planning and scheduling to optimize maintenance activities.

GENERAL SUMMARY
As a key member of the Division Management team, the Controller will report to the
Corporate Controller and assume a strategic role in the management and
financial reporting for the operating division. The Controller will have
primary day-to-day responsibility for planning, implementing, managing, and
controlling all financial-related activities of the division. This will include
direct responsibility for general accounting, finance, forecasting, strategic
planning, costing, payables, order entry, billing, cost accounting, bill of
materials, business analysis and financial reporting. The Controller will also liaison with shared service financial staff as required.
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
Lead
Strategy, Planning, and Management.
Act
as Finance Manager/Controller and strategic business partner to division leadership
team. Serve as a key member of NASG
Finance team.
Assess and evaluate
financial performance of division with regard to long term operational goals,
budgets and forecasts.
Provide insight and
recommendations to both short term and long term growth plan of the division.
Support ERP systems and
software to provide critical financial and operational information. Evaluate departments and make suggestions for
automating processes and increasing working efficiency.
Communicate, engage,
and interact with local management group and NASG senior leadership team.
Create and establish
yearly divisional financial objectives that align with the company's plan for
growth and expansion.
Oversee controls and
payback calculations of capital expenditures.
Support consultants and
auditors as directed/engaged by the shared services group.
Implement policies,
procedures and processes as deemed appropriate by shared service leadership
team.
Direct
Financial Analysis, Budgeting, and Forecasting.
Prepare and present
division monthly financial budgeting reports, monthly profit and loss,
forecast, and variance reports.
Review and analyze
monthly financial results and provide recommendations.
Maintain monthly operating
budget and annual division operating budget.
Provide the financial
planning and analysis function for the division. Participate in creation of
reports, software implementation, and tools for budgeting and forecasting.
Participate in periodic
conference calls with operations management, vendors, and shared service leadership
team.
Prepare periodic sales
variance reports and explain variations to plan and/or trends.
Work with the sales
team to validate/audit all customer pricing changes.
Oversee
Accounting, General Ledger, Administration and Operations.
Lead the accounting
department to ensure the proper functioning of all systems, databases, and
financial software. Ensure regular
maintenance and backup of all accounting systems. Supervise division financial staff.
Review and ensure
application of appropriate internal controls, and financial procedures.
Ensure timeliness and
accuracy of financial and management reporting data for federal funders,
investors, and company's board of directors.
Monitor financial
information and provide for the preparation and timely filing of all local,
state, and federal tax returns.
Work with Human
Resources to ensure appropriate legal compliance.
Manage/Participate in
the month end close process, constantly reviewing procedures while eliminating
inefficiencies.
Review all month-end
closing activities including general ledger accounts, balance sheet accounts,
and overhead cost allocation.
Recruit, interview,
hire, develop, and manage finance, accounting, and payroll staff as required.
Serve as a key point of
contact for external auditors related to the division. Manage preparation and support of all
external audits.
Coordinate and
strategize methods used to attain team goals with Finance staff of the division
and shared services team.
Manage Cost and Inventory Accounting.
Understand bills of
materials to ensure product costs are accurate and accounted for properly.
Ensure timely and
accurate input of bills of materials and price code changes.
Ensure bills of
materials and costing accurately reflect production operations.
Analyze potential
excess and obsolete inventory items as necessary
Attend daily production
meetings to understand all operations decisions affecting the business.
Ensure accuracy of the
physical inventory and reported results.
Investigate and explain book to physical adjustments.
Review scrap sales
reporting to ensure accuracy.
Direct
Cash Management for the Division.
Oversee weekly cash
management.
Oversee Accounts Payable
Department, approve/review large payables, sign checks, and authorize large
wires and ACHs.
Supervise Accounts
Receivable management and provide guidance relating to the collection process.
Work with the Division
operations team to reduce inventory levels and approve Net Working Capital
position.
Serve
as Finance Business Partner for the Division.
Attend all AP/QP
meetings.
Provide support for
Financial Review meetings and review/approve financial related KPI data.
Perform periodic
walkthroughs of the plant with the Operations Manager/General Manager to
discuss production and costing issues.
Review labor reporting
and cost, material cost, manufacturing overhead, distribution cost, quality
cost, and inventory levels.
Conduct formal meetings
with manufacturing, finance and management personnel to discuss all plant
issues. Develop and publish a formal
agenda and recap with actions to be taken.
